Abstract

The invention discloses a device and a method for remotely and automatically dropping fracturing balls continuously. The device includes a hollow-structure annular guide box, in which a ball pushing column is arranged, and the annular hollow structure includes a space for accommodating fracturing balls, The channel for pushing the ball column and the movement of the fracturing ball; the annular guide box is provided with the entrance of the fracturing ball and the limit ball outlet, and the limit slide block and the ball stopper are set at the limit ball outlet, and the top surface of the limit ball outlet The top surface higher than the limit sliding block gradually decreases from the inside to the outside. The limit sliding block is connected with a drive device that drives it to reciprocate along the axial direction of the annular guide box. The control signal input end of the drive device is connected to the output end of the remote controller. The push ball column includes a driving end and a driven end that are connected to each other. The driven end and the fracturing ball are located in the same channel, which can realize automatic and continuous delivery of the fracturing ball, instead of manual single delivery or automatic non-continuous delivery. Thereby improving the timeliness of the factory zipper operation of the platform well.

technical field [0001] The invention belongs to the field of perforation and well completion, and in particular relates to a device and method for remotely and automatically releasing fracturing balls, in particular to a device and method for automatically and continuously releasing fracturing balls for remote plugging and unplugging connectors at wellheads. Background technique [0002] Large-scale staged fracturing technology is a key technology for the development of low-porosity and low-permeability unconventional oil and gas resources such as shale gas and tight oil and gas, and bridge plug perforation combined with sand fracturing is an important part of it.
